Handy information about Kheria Airport (AGR)
Kheria Airport has an excellent on-time performance, making delays less likely. Departures from AGR land on schedule 88.71% of the time.
Kheria Airport is around 5 kilometres from central Agra. If you're catching a cab, ride-sharing or driving from the centre, it'll take 15 minutes or so to get there, depending on the traffic.
Planning to catch public transport? You can expect a journey time of around 1 hour 10 minutes.

Getting from Chandigarh Airport (IXC) to central Chandigarh
Chandigarh Airport is roughly 6 kilometres from the centre of Chandigarh. The drive time takes about 20 minutes.
Getting there on public transport will take you roughly 1 hour 5 minutes.
When to fly to Chandigarh Airport (IXC)
It's time to work out your travel dates for your flight from Kheria Airport to Chandigarh Airport. July is the most popular month to visit Chandigarh. If you like a more low-key vibe, go in April.
Book your flight from Kheria Airport to Chandigarh Airport for June if you'd like to explore Chandigarh during its warmest month. Expect temperatures of between 24ºC (75ºF) and 41ºC (106ºF).
If you want to travel in c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from AGR to IXC in January. Average temperatures are between 5ºC (41ºF) and 22ºC (72ºF) then.
